What is the effect of pressure on (i) viscosity, (ii) surface tension, (iii) density of liquid ?

i) As the pressure increases, the viscosity of a fluid also increases. so they are directly proportional.
ii) As pressure increases, surface tension decreases. they are inversely proportional.
iii) As pressure increases, the density of a liquid increases. they are directly proportional.
